黑马程序员技术交流社区

标题: 面向对象 [打印本页]

作者: luguo    时间: 2015-6-11 11:03
标题: 面向对象
实例话对象有的两种办法:   NSObject *o1=[NSObject new];    NSObject *o2=[[NSObject alloc] init];  实例话出的对象是没区别的,但第二中方法是可以指定构造方法(init)的名称,有利于多态,保证了灵活性,所以后面一律使用第二种方法。     
二。每个类只有一个父类,如果不指名默认为NSObject。(继承的单根性)     这点与C++不同。  
   三。新的“数据类型” id  作用完全等同于:  NSObject * 也就是说id是对象指针。




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2